Chapter 83: Playing One More Tricky Angle Chapter 83: Playing One More Tricky Angle Abuchi, who had been silent this whole time, cleared his throat.
“I think…
perhaps we misunderstood.
Of course, your studies are important.
Maybe we can…
figure something out?” The mention of the first prince had effectively cornered Obinna and Abuchi, leaving them unable to neatly wriggle out of the discussion.
Defying their elder brother’s authority was out of the question, so they exchanged glances, silently agreeing it was best to compromise.
Before the tension could boil over further, King Ikechukwu finally intervened, his tone calm but authoritative.
“Nnenna,” he began, “you will not be in charge of supervising the entire preparation for the celebration.
That is the housekeeper’s responsibility, that is his job.” At his words, relief washed over Nnenna’s face, but everyone else at the table seemed displeased.
The king, however, wasn’t finished.
“But,” he continued, his tone sharpening and immediately sparking their interest, “you will need to make some time to ensure everything is in order.
You have worked with the servants for years, and I trust your judgment.
Work alongside the housekeeper.
You won’t be doing the work, but you will supervise and coordinate with him to make sure everything is perfect for your sister’s birthday celebration.” He paused for a moment, watching the room’s reactions, then added, “And let’s not forget, this is also your birthday celebration.
You should put in more effort.
After all, this is your day too.” The mood in the room shifted instantly.
Ebere, Queen Chioma, and even the brothers perked up, excitement flickering in their eyes.
The king’s framing of the task as a dual responsibility for her birthday and her sister’s made it clear they now had an angle.
